What if every decision you make, every quantum event, and every possibility branches into its own reality?

Infinite Realities: Journey into the Multiverse and Quantum Many-Worlds takes readers deep into one of the most profound and controversial ideas in modern physics: the many-worlds interpretation of quantum mechanics and its implications for a true multiverse.

This book explores how the seemingly bizarre rules of the quantum world—superposition, entanglement, and wave-function collapse, lead some physicists to conclude that reality itself may continually split into countless parallel versions. From the foundations laid by Hugh Everett III to contemporary debates among cosmologists and quantum theorists, the narrative traces the scientific and philosophical arguments for (and against) the existence of infinite realities.

Clear explanations, carefully chosen thought experiments, and connections to cutting-edge research make complex concepts accessible without oversimplification. Readers will encounter the measurement problem, decoherence, the role of the observer, and the startling possibility that every quantum outcome is realized somewhere.

Whether you are a curious non-specialist, a student of physics or philosophy, or someone simply drawn to the biggest questions about existence, this book offers a rigorous yet readable journey into the idea that our universe may be only one among infinitely many.

No prior advanced physics background is required, only a willingness to follow the evidence and consider what it might mean for the nature of reality.
